feat(01-02): wire build-logic into root settings + add spotless/flyway classloader hints
- settings.gradle.kts: includeBuild("build-logic") placed inside pluginManagement { } (PITFALL #9)
- build.gradle.kts: 2 new alias(...) apply false entries (spotless, flywayPlugin)
- Existing repositories, module includes, and 8 original apply-false entries preserved verbatim
This commit is contained in:
@@ -9,4 +9,6 @@ plugins {
|
|||||||
alias(libs.plugins.kotlinJvm) apply false
|
alias(libs.plugins.kotlinJvm) apply false
|
||||||
alias(libs.plugins.kotlinMultiplatform) apply false
|
alias(libs.plugins.kotlinMultiplatform) apply false
|
||||||
alias(libs.plugins.ktor) apply false
|
alias(libs.plugins.ktor) apply false
|
||||||
|
alias(libs.plugins.spotless) apply false
|
||||||
|
alias(libs.plugins.flywayPlugin) apply false
|
||||||
}
|
}
|
||||||
@@ -2,6 +2,7 @@ rootProject.name = "recipe"
|
|||||||
enableFeaturePreview("TYPESAFE_PROJECT_ACCESSORS")
|
enableFeaturePreview("TYPESAFE_PROJECT_ACCESSORS")
|
||||||
|
|
||||||
pluginManagement {
|
pluginManagement {
|
||||||
|
includeBuild("build-logic")
|
||||||
repositories {
|
repositories {
|
||||||
google {
|
google {
|
||||||
mavenContent {
|
mavenContent {
|
||||||
|
|||||||
Reference in New Issue
Block a user